/*
 * computes the time taken to read/write data in a flash element
 * using just one active page.
 */
static void ssd_compute_access_time_one_active_page
(ssd_req **reqs, int total, int elem_num, ssd_t *s)
{
    // we assume that requests have been broken down into page sized chunks
    double cost;
    int blkno;
    int count;
    int is_read;
    ssd_power_element_stat *power_stat = &(s->elements[elem_num].power_stat);

    // we can serve only one request at a time
    ASSERT(total == 1);

    blkno = reqs[0]->blk;
    count = reqs[0]->count;
    is_read = reqs[0]->is_read;

    if (is_read) {
        cost = ssd_read_policy_simple(count, s, power_stat);
        
    } else {
        cost = ssd_write_one_active_page(blkno, count, elem_num, s);
    }

    reqs[0]->acctime = cost;
    reqs[0]->schtime = cost;
}

/*
 * computes the time taken to read/write data in a flash element
 * using just one active page.
 */
static void ssd_compute_access_time_one_active_page
(ssd_req **reqs, int total, int elem_num, ssd_t *s)
{
    // we assume that requests have been broken down into page sized chunks
    double cost;
    int blkno;
    int count;
    int is_read;

    // we can serve only one request at a time
    ASSERT(total == 1);

    blkno = reqs[0]->blk;
    count = reqs[0]->count;
    is_read = reqs[0]->is_read;

    if (is_read) {
        // there are no separate read policies.
        switch(s->params.write_policy) {
            case DISKSIM_SSD_WRITE_POLICY_SIMPLE:
            case DISKSIM_SSD_WRITE_POLICY_OSR:
                // the cost of one page read
                cost = ssd_read_policy_simple(count, s);
                break;

            default:
                fprintf(stderr, "Error: unknown write policy %d in ssd_compute_access_time\n",
                    s->params.write_policy);
                exit(1);
        }
    } else {
        switch(s->params.write_policy) {
            case DISKSIM_SSD_WRITE_POLICY_SIMPLE:
                cost = ssd_write_policy_simple(blkno, count, elem_num, s);
                break;

            case DISKSIM_SSD_WRITE_POLICY_OSR:
                cost = ssd_write_one_active_page(blkno, count, elem_num, s);
                break;

            default:
                fprintf(stderr, "Error: unknown write policy %d in ssd_compute_access_time\n",
                    s->params.write_policy);
                exit(1);
        }
    }

    reqs[0]->acctime = cost;
    reqs[0]->schtime = cost;
}
